Course Update – 11 February 2019
We are pleased to report the course is in good condition albeit the fairways have browned off. After a very dry spring and summer to date (3mm vs 40mm January average) and the need to ration current available water, only the greens, surrounds, tees and selected fairways are being watered. The Island Is King
Long famed for its cheese, free-range beef and laid-back atmosphere, King Island in Bass Strait is also quickly becoming known on a global scale for its amazing, world-class golf.
